zweistündig

German[edit]

Etymology[edit]

zwei +‎ Stunde +‎ -ig

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/ˈt͡svaɪ̯ˌʃtʏndɪç/ (standard)
  • IPA(key): /-ˌʃtʏndɪk/ (common form in southern Germany, Austria, and Switzerland)
  • (file)
  • Hyphenation: zwei‧stün‧dig

Adjective[edit]

zweistündig (strong nominative masculine singular zweistündiger, not comparable)

  1. (relational) two-hour
    Synonym: 2-stündig
